Top neighbourhoods in Cairo

Zamalek

Zamalek Island offers a sophisticated Cairo escape where tree-lined streets lead to cultural treasures and Nile views. Art lovers flock to contemporary galleries and the Cairo Opera House, while foodies sample upscale international cuisine at riverside restaurants. The neighborhood's Belle Époque architecture and embassy buildings create an atmosphere of elegant charm away from downtown's hustle. You'll find boutique hotels and luxury accommodation nestled among leafy streets, many with stunning river panoramas. Getting around is easy with taxis readily available and pleasant walking paths along the Nile corniche. The nearby Safaa Hegazy metro station connects you to greater Cairo when you're ready to explore beyond this refined island oasis.

Downtown Cairo

City centre Cairo blends Belle Époque grandeur with revolutionary energy around Tahrir Square. The Egyptian Museum showcases pharaonic treasures while traditional coffeehouses serve cardamom tea amid shisha smoke. Explore ornate 19th-century buildings, browse authentic papyrus shops, or witness local life at bustling ahwas between sightseeing adventures. Metro stations like Orabi and Nasser make getting around easy despite the traffic. Dining ranges from street food vendors offering fresh ta'ameya to upscale hotel restaurants with Nile views. Historic hotels with colonial charm dominate the accommodation scene, putting you steps away from Cairo's cultural heart.

Garden City

Garden City offers a glimpse into Cairo's aristocratic past with colonial-era mansions and diplomatic buildings lining its tree-canopied streets. The peaceful area sits along the Nile Corniche, where manicured embassy gardens and grand facades create an elegant atmosphere away from the city's hustle. Upscale restaurants in luxury hotels serve refined Egyptian dishes alongside international cuisine. Getting around is simple with readily available taxis and ride-sharing services, while the wide, well-maintained pavements make walking a pleasure. Most travellers choose from luxury hotels or boutique properties in converted mansions.

Heliopolis

Heliopolis blends historic grandeur with modern Cairo's upscale energy. The fairy-tale Baron Empain Palace stands tall with its Hindu-inspired towers, while Art Nouveau villas line tree-shaded boulevards. Wander through the distinctive Korba area to admire elegant early 20th-century mansions with ornate balconies. The area buzzes with cafes, restaurants, and the impressive Tivoli Dome. Dining options range from traditional Egyptian eateries to trendy cafes along Korba's main strips. Cairo Metro Line 3 connects you seamlessly to city centre, with El Nozha, Alf Maskan, and Heliopolis stations all within reach. For shopping, head to City Stars Mall or explore local boutiques selling authentic Egyptian crafts.

Maadi

Maadi delivers a peaceful oasis where tree-lined streets and spacious villas create a refreshing escape from Cairo's intensity. The neighborhood's international vibe shines through diverse restaurants and cafés along Road 9. Catch live music, stroll the Nile Corniche, or explore the nearby Wadi Degla nature reserve when you need a breath of fresh air. Getting around couldn't be easier with two metro stations connecting you to city centre Cairo in just 30 minutes. Accommodation options range from boutique hotels to serviced apartments in converted villas, often featuring garden courtyards and pools. The leafy streets are wonderfully walkable, making Maadi perfect for travellers seeking Cairo's cosmopolitan side without the crowds.

Best time to go to Cairo

Cairo exper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 57.6°F (14.2°C), while August is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 87.3°F (30.7°C). March tends to be the wettest month. The peak travel months to visit Cairo are June, July, and September, which see a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is sunny, accompanied by no rainfall. In contrast, May, October, and November are ideal if you're looking for a calmer vacation, marked by no rainfall and sunny conditions.
